Despite being situated inland, away from the coast, this urban beach along the Pisuerga River provides locals and visitors alike with a wonderful spot to relax, unwind, and enjoy various recreational pursuits.
The beach is adorned with soft golden sand and lined with a lush expanse of trees, predominantly mulberry trees (“moreras” in Spanish) from which it gets its name. These trees provide ample shade, creating a serene and inviting atmosphere that sets the stage for a peaceful day by the water.
While it may not offer waves like a coastal beach, Playa de Las Moreras compensates with an array of recreational activities. The wide sandy stretch is perfect for beach volleyball, picnicking, or simply lounging with a good book. The calm waters of the Pisuerga River allow for kayaking, paddleboarding, and even swimming in designated areas. The beachfront promenade provides a pleasant space for walking, jogging, or cycling, making it an ideal spot for outdoor enthusiasts.
The beach is family-friendly and attracts people of all ages. The shallow waters near the shoreline make it safe for children to splash around, and the well-maintained facilities, including clean restrooms and convenient parking, add to the overall comfort of visitors.
